"For I the LORD thy God will hold thy right hand, saying unto thee, Fear not; I will help thee." Isaiah 41:13
Even though the expression "For I the LORD thy God will hold thy right hand" contextually mean "I will strengthen you", we will use it to mean "I will lead you".
Recently, I went to pick my daughter in school and as we walk home she refused that I hold her hand. Rather, she prefer to hold my hand. As she held my hand excitedly I remember saying "If you hold my hand, you may fall. Let me hold you so you won't fall". That was a statement that provoked some thoughts in my heart.
Many want to hold God's hands, desiring that He follows them in pursuit of their selfish interests; wanting Him to approve all they want to do thereby making Him a rubber stamp God. That way of life or attitude has cost many their footing in the faith.
God is our Father, He knows every details about the path of life wherein we thread now, let us put our hands into His hands so He can lead us as the good shepherd and we shall be safe all through the journey of life.
May we not lose our footing in the faith in Jesus' name.
